New vs Old power - The 9th Annual Thunder on the Prairies roared into Odessa on Friday and Saturday. Organizers say this was the biggest weekend on record, with around 4,000 to 5,000 visitors. Truck and tractor pulls were the main event, with around 60 modified units and 20 antiques participating, including two steam-powered tractors. (Ashley Scarfe/Grasslands News)
It was a high-octane weekend in Odessa as the ninth annual Thunder on the Prairies rolled into town on Friday. An estimated 4,000 to 5,000 people attended the event, whose proceeds go entirely toward supporting Odessa and the surrounding communities.
